First, there was Episode 31: TXA for Epistaxis (the Zahed RCT from Tehran), then there was Episode 40: TXA for Epistaxis, Part Deux (the NoPAC trial), now there's Episode 64: TXA for Epistaxis, Part Trois, another Iranian RCT.
So... we have conflicted evidence, all from RCTs, about whether TXA works for epistaxis. Dr. Jarvis goes through the prior trials and then gives a more detailed look at the new evidence. He closes by talking about how he handles conflicting evidence.

Citation:
Hosseinialhashemi M, Jahangiri R, Faramarzi A, et al. Intranasal Topical Application of Tranexamic Acid in Atraumatic Anterior Epistaxis: A Double-Blind Randomized Clinical Trial. Annals of Emergency Medicine. 2022;80(3):182-188. doi:10.1016/j.annemergmed.2022.04.010See om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.

What is The EMS Lighthouse Project?

The EMS Lighthouse Project Podcast exists to foster knowledge translation from peer-reviewed scientific journals to the street. Join Mike Verkest and Dr. Jeff Jarvis as they shine the bright light of science on EMS practice in an informative and fun way.
